struts2.0 如何用iterator显示list<String[]>中对象的内容

在Action中有一个私有的list属性:privateList<String[]>adminList;并且有getter和setter方法,adminList中已经赋上... 在Action中有一个私有的list属性:
private List<String[]> adminList;
并且有getter和setter方法,adminList中已经赋上值了,如何在页面中使用iterator显示adminList中的值?(String数组里有两个元素)

还在学习阶段,对这些不懂,希望高手们指点一下!谢谢!
展开
 我来答
向日中秋圆E
2009-09-05 · TA获得超过1004个赞
知道小有建树答主
回答量:653
采纳率:0%
帮助的人:528万
展开全部
你如果通过struts.xml配置跳转信息,在你跳转页面:比如index.jsp中,使用struts2的iterator标签来取值
实质是在valueStack的值,就是内存区中的值栈。
可以先使用s:debug标签,看一下值栈中有什么内容
itrator进行遍历的
1 <s:iterator value="listMenu" id="adminList"/> 这里就是你action中的属性,对应你的adminList
如果没有使用setter和getter方法,可以通过reuqest.setAttribute来传值
<s:iterator value="#request.adminList" id="adminList">
2.通过id,运用el表达式直接取值
比如你要取
${adminList}
或者继续通过struts2标签来操作
<s:property value=""/>
最终通过这些标签,实现遍历。
注意:这些标签在
<s:iterator value="listMenu"></s:iterator>中间,才能遍历。
百度网友bf26c25f0
推荐于2016-11-30
知道答主
回答量:17
采纳率:0%
帮助的人:13.2万
展开全部
<%
List<String[]> list = new ArrayList<String[]>();
String [] str = {"1","2","3","4"};
String [] str1 = {"a","b","c","d"};
list.add(str);
list.add(str1);
request.setAttribute("list",list);
%>
<s:iterator value="#attr.list" id="str">
<s:iterator value="str" id="s">
<s:property value="s" />
</s:iterator>
</s:iterator>
这样迭代,你试试 .如果有什么地方不懂可以直接问我
本回答被提问者采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
heleisg
2009-09-05
知道答主
回答量:70
采纳率:0%
帮助的人:26.5万
展开全部
<logic:iterate id="pf" name="SwpForm" property="dateList" type="jp.co.ob.swp.SwpInfo">
<bean:write name="pf" property="makeDate" />
</logic:iterate>

iterate id=bean:write name

iterate property = 是在actionFORM中定义的LIST,

iterate type =是存在LIST中的对象类也就是存要输出的String的对象,有getter和setter方法的类

bean:write property = 要输出的Stirng的定义的名字
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
御用灌水师
2009-09-05 · TA获得超过1573个赞
知道小有建树答主
回答量:473
采纳率:0%
帮助的人:727万
展开全部
最简单的是用JSP的JSTL核心标签
<c:forEach items="adminList" var="str">
${str}
</c:forEach>
记得导入JSTL标签库
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(2)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式